The Pharmacology of Fentanyl Citrate
Fentanyl citrate works by binding primarily to the mu-opioid receptors in the main worried system. These receptors are responsible for regulating the understanding of pain. When fentanyl binds to these receptors, it increases the pain threshold and modifies the emotional reaction to discomfort.
The "citrate" in fentanyl citrate refers to the salt form of the drug, which is highly soluble and suitable for injectable formulations. Unlike lots of other opioids, fentanyl is extremely lipid-soluble, permitting it to cross the blood-brain barrier almost instantly. This results in a rapid analgesic result, making it perfect for severe surgical settings.
Table 1: Comparison of Fentanyl to Common Opioids
| Feature | Fentanyl | Morphine | Hydromorphone |
|---|---|---|---|
| Relative Potency | 100x | 1x | 5x-- 7x |
| Beginning (IV) | 1-- 2 minutes | 5-- 10 minutes | 5 minutes |
| Duration of Action | 30-- 60 minutes | 3-- 5 hours | 3-- 4 hours |
| Lipid Solubility | Extremely High | Low | Moderate |
Medical Indications in the UK
In the UK, fentanyl citrate injection is booked for specific clinical environments, normally health centers, hospices, or specialized discomfort clinics. It is not a medication that is self-administered by clients in your home in its injectable form.
Primary Medical Uses:
- Analgesic Adjunct in Anesthesia: It is utilized before and during surgery to maintain stable pain control and lower the amount of volatile anesthetic required.
- Management of Severe Chronic Pain: In specialized cases, it may be used for advancement pain management in clients already receiving long-lasting opioid therapy, such as those in palliative care.
- Induction of Anesthesia: Often utilized in combination with other representatives to induce a state of unconsciousness for surgeries.
- Post-Operative Recovery: Administered in a Controlled Recovery Unit (CRU) to manage immediate, intense discomfort following significant surgical treatment.
Legal Status and Procurement in the UK
The procurement of Fentanyl Citrate Injection in the UK is governed by strict laws to prevent abuse and diversion. It is classified under the Misuse of Drugs Act 1971 as a Class A drug and is additional categorized as a Schedule 2 Controlled Drug (CD) under the Misuse of Drugs Regulations 2001.
Comprehending the Regulations:
- Prescription Requirements: It can just be prescribed by licensed healthcare specialists (generally doctors or specialized nurse prescribers).
- Safe Custody: Hospitals and drug stores must save fentanyl in a locked, double-bolted controlled drug cabinet.
- Record Keeping: Every milligram of fentanyl need to be represented in a Controlled Drugs Register, tracking the stock from the producer to the client's bedside.
- The "Buy UK" Context: For health care entities (like private health centers or centers), fentanyl is "purchased" through certified pharmaceutical wholesalers. For individual clients, it is never "bought" over the counter; it is provided as part of a medically monitored treatment plan.
List: Who Can Legally Handle Fentanyl Citrate in the UK?
- Licensed Medical Practitioners (Doctors).
- Registered Pharmacists in a medical facility or medical setting.
- Qualified Nurses (throughout administration under guidance).
- Certified Pharmaceutical Wholesalers.

The Threat of Respiratory Depression
The most considerable risk associated with fentanyl citrate injection is breathing depression. Fentanyl decreases the brain's sensitivity to co2 levels, which can trigger the client to stop breathing completely. This is why it is strictly administered in environments where resuscitative equipment and opioid villains (like Naloxone) are instantly offered.

Signs of a Fentanyl Overdose
Prompt acknowledgment of an overdose can save lives. If an overdose is believed, emergency situation services (999) must be gotten in touch with immediately.
- Pinpoint students.
- Blue or grey tint to lips and fingernails (cyanosis).
- Slow, shallow, or stopped breathing.
- Limp body and failure to be gotten up.
- Gurgling or choking noises.

3. How is Fentanyl Citrate Injection administered?
It can be administered Intravenously (IV), Intramuscularly (IM), or through an epidural/spinal route. In a health center, it is typically delivered via a PCA (Patient-Controlled Analgesia) pump which has built-in security limitations.
4. What is the role of Naloxone?
Naloxone is an opioid villain. It can temporarily reverse the results of a fentanyl overdose by displacing the particles from the opioid receptors, bring back normal breathing.
